The Brand Consistency Crisis: Why Enterprises Are Struggling
Enterprise marketing teams aim for a unified brand story, yet daily operations often fragment that story across regions, channels, and partners. Large organizations work across paid, owned, and earned media, where small deviations in visuals or messaging quickly add up.
Operational chaos now poses a greater threat to brand consistency than a lack of creativity, especially in organizations with complex structures and rapid content needs.
Decentralized Content Creation
Multiple teams and agencies often operate without a single source of truth, which leads to fragmented messaging and inconsistent execution. Regional offices, external agencies, and internal departments interpret guidelines in their own ways, creating variations in logos, colors, layouts, and copy. Over time, this erodes recognition and weakens the brand.
Scalability Strain
Fast growth and multi-channel campaigns strain manual content workflows. Teams must support TikTok, email, LinkedIn, websites, and traditional media while working under tight deadlines. Pressure to publish quickly often pushes brand compliance to the background, and off-brand assets slip through.
Scattered Brand Assets
Outdated templates and scattered brand assets slow teams down and introduce errors. Marketers spend time searching for files across shared drives, old email threads, or local folders. Many settle for whatever they can find, even if it is not current or fully compliant, which compounds inconsistencies across campaigns.

Core Pillars of Consistent Brand Identity Automation with AI
AI content automation supports consistency through structured rules, centralized assets, and repeatable workflows that work across teams and regions.
Automated Visual Identity Support
AI tools can combine generated visuals with expert design direction to maintain brand standards at scale. Systems can check logo placement, colors, typography, and imagery style against predefined rules, which reduces the need for manual corrections and helps every asset look and feel on-brand.

Aligned Messaging and Tone of Voice
AI systems can generate copy that follows documented tone-of-voice guidelines, such as preferred vocabulary, sentence length, and formality level. This helps social posts, emails, landing pages, and ad copy sound like they came from the same brand, even when many different contributors are involved.
Scalability and Speed with Quality Checks
AI content tools enable teams to produce more assets in less time while retaining guardrails around quality. Clear rules and review thresholds allow teams to move faster on routine content, while still escalating more complex or sensitive work to human reviewers.
Centralized Brand Asset Management Integration
Brand asset management platforms act as the single source of truth for approved logos, imagery, fonts, and templates. AI tools that plug into these systems can automatically pull the correct assets into new content, which minimizes outdated or off-brand files and keeps teams aligned on current standards.

Implementing Consistent Brand Identity Automation: Best Practices for Enterprises
Effective implementation depends on clear standards, thoughtful integration, and a plan for continuous improvement.
Defining Comprehensive Digital Brand Guidelines
Strong AI performance starts with precise, digital-first brand guidelines. These should define hex codes, typography rules, image styles, logo usage, tone-of-voice examples, and platform-specific variations. Well-documented rules become the reference set that AI systems use to generate and evaluate content.
Integrating AI into Existing Workflows
AI tools work best when they slot into current production, approval, and publishing processes. Mapping existing workflows, identifying repeatable steps, and embedding AI at those points creates efficiency without disrupting governance. Training and clear roles help teams understand when to rely on automation and when to escalate to human review.
Maintaining Human Oversight and Iteration
Human judgment remains critical for strategy, storytelling, and cultural relevance. Regular reviews of AI-generated outputs allow teams to fine-tune prompts, update rules, and respond to changes in brand positioning or market conditions. This ongoing cycle keeps automation aligned with evolving brand goals.
